Bloxwich to Canley by train

A train trip from Bloxwich to Canley takes about 1hrs 31 mins on average, covering roughly 24 miles (39 kilometres). With around 35 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£2.90,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Amenities at Bloxwich Station

Though small, Bloxwich Station provides several essential amenities to cater to its travelers. It is equipped with ticket machines for easy ticket collection, even for those purchased online, ensuring a seamless start to your journey. Accessibility is a consideration, with step-free access to platforms, although it may include some longer or steeper ramps. For those needing assistance, the station offers help points, although it's worth noting that there are no staff to physically assist passengers at the station.

For those who prefer digital interactions, there’s no need to worry about long wait times; assistance can be booked via the Passenger Assist service up to two hours before your departure. Unfortunately, luxuries like Wi-Fi, restaurants, or retail shops are not available, but the station does uphold a comfortable seating area for those awaiting their train.

Facilities and Services at Canley Station

At Canley Station, the ticket office operates with convenient hours throughout the week, ensuring that you can easily purchase or collect your pre-bought tickets using the ticket machines available on-site. These machines are accessible for those requiring additional assistance, alongside induction loop systems for the hearing impaired.

Security and customer support are prioritized at Canley Station. Staff are available during varied hours, and the station is equipped with CCTV for safety. Additionally, Canley is accredited by the Secure Station Scheme, reinforcing the commitment to passenger security.

Accessibility

Canley Station boasts step-free access, ensuring all platforms are reachable for passengers with mobility needs, classified as a Category A station. While accessible ticket machines and ramps for train access are present, it's important to note the absence of accessible toilets and wheelchairs at the station. For those driving, there are four designated accessible parking spaces available.
